Darren Pearson (no relation) has managed to create a short film called Lightspeed that uses light paintings as characters, and the result is a breathtaking piece that makes me wonder how he pulled all of this off. It's not only the creation and execution of multiple light paintings (he apparently hand-drew all of them, over 1000 in total), but it's combining them with moving timelapse photography that seems like it would often be gorgeous just on its own. Look at the :48 second mark as an example: there's a painted wolf in the foreground, but there's also a timelapse of the night sky that's pretty stunning to behold when you take the entire image into account.
